And most it was their first SANFL A grade game. We were always on a hiding to nothing. Its why I found it hard to get motivated to go to the game.

This thinking we have so much depth and will dominate the sanfl just got a decent reality check.
My reality check was when RossFC posted our probable line-up. Yes, we have depth; but it does not go deep enough to form a second team. Using your Top-16 rule as a guideline, our depth would probably go to – exaggerating – #30. It is awesome for the Power, but not near enough to be actually good for the Maggies.

The Magpies would be 15 players short, in the best case scenario. That's where the top-up rules hurt us. It is more than half of the entire Magpie line-up, and injuries only make it worse.

The Maggies will get better, no doubt. However, the ceiling doesn't seem high enough for letting us to run deep in the Finals. I hope I am wrong.

Hayes was a monster in ruck. Must have finished with 40+ hitouts but it was how clear and decisive those hitouts were. Absolute dominance. Wasn’t much of a factor when the ball was on the ground or in contests though. Clunked and contested aerially around the ground. He’s the exact opposite player of ladhams.

jones. - Sloppy as all hell with the ball but massive workrate and endeavour

Farrell - good first half where he was our only player clean with possession and worked hard as well. Didn’t see him at all in the second. Honestly think he might be flying over as an emergency.

Lienert - some sloppiness that got better as the game went on. Worked hard but too much work for him to do alone. Showed he is still good depth.

McKenzie - poor game with a couple of good moments but so far off from his best. First game back so hopefully will build

Sutcliffe - bad game. He’s an experienced afl player and he was dominated by his opponents all night. Huge reason we lost that game

mayes - tried hard. Didn’t have as much impact as he should have with that much of the ball

Schofield - bad first half. Great disposal is meant to be his bag so was annoying to see his skills get ports immediately. Good second half.

rockliff - trash league. Rocky copped a lot of attention from Norwood that the umps just entirely let go. So unsurprising that he got injured that I predicted it 1 minute before it happened. campaigners.

woodcock - horrible game

mead - still a tonne of work to do before he even gets near our 22. It’s scary that he’s currently a starting mid in our seconds team.

Frederick - got better but has established that he’s not a threat to anyone in our 22. Stagnated at this level.

Garner - horrid start and rose to just being poor by the end. Disappointed that he looks to have gone backwards

lord -not much to say.

Williams - one of few who could impact when he touched it, just didn’t touch it anywhere near enough. Still a long term project. I don’t think he plays afl this year

so many passengers and fringe players expected to fill key roles in this side.
